Camera Nikon D5

The Nikon D5 camera is a renowned SLR model known for its exceptional image quality. With a 20.8 MP CMOS sensor and a maximum resolution of 5568 x 3712 pixels, it allows for capturing precise details and rich colors, making it ideal for professional photographers and photography enthusiasts.

The Nikon D5 offers flexibility in use thanks to its various autofocus modes, including Multi Point Auto Focus and Single Auto Focus, ensuring sharp images in various situations. Its 3.2-inch AMOLED touchscreen, which is tiltable, makes composing photos and accessing settings easier.

In terms of video, the D5 allows recording in 4K Ultra HD, guaranteeing optimal image quality for capturing moving moments. Its built-in microphone and stereo audio system enhance the sound recording experience.

Equipped with an optical viewfinder for precise framing, the Nikon D5 also features numerous shooting modes and photographic effects to enrich your creations. With its PictBridge and USB 3.2 connectivity, it facilitates data transfer and direct printing.

Designed to withstand various usage conditions, the Nikon D5 operates within a temperature range of 0 to 40 °C. Weighing 1240 g, it remains lightweight and easy to handle for everyday use.

In summary, the Nikon D5 is a high-performance camera, offering advanced features to capture high-quality images and videos while remaining accessible and practical for all users.

How can I adjust the ISO settings on my Nikon D5?
To change the ISO settings on your Nikon D5, press the ISO button located on the top of the camera, then use the command dial to adjust the ISO value.
What autofocus modes are available on the Nikon D5?
The Nikon D5 offers several autofocus modes, such as single-point AF mode, dynamic-area AF mode, and 3D tracking mode. You can switch between modes using the AF-Mode button on the back of the camera and the control ring.
How can I change the white balance settings on my Nikon D5?
To adjust the white balance settings on your Nikon D5, press the WB button on the top of the camera and turn the main dial to select the desired preset, or use the sub-command dial to fine-tune the white balance.
How do I take photos in continuous burst mode with my Nikon D5?
To shoot in burst mode with your Nikon D5, select the Continuous (CH) shooting mode by turning the mode dial to CH. Then, press and hold the shutter button to capture a series of images.
How do I manually set the shutter speed and aperture on my Nikon D5?
To manually adjust the shutter speed and aperture on your Nikon D5, switch to manual exposure mode by turning the mode dial to M. Then use the command dial to set the shutter speed and the secondary dial for the aperture.

Presentation of product D5 specifications from brand Nikon

General Information

The Nikon D5 is a digital single-lens reflex camera from the Nikon brand, known for its excellence in photography and technological innovation. This model, designated by the code D5 | VBA460AE, offers remarkable performance and an enhanced user experience. Its EAN code, 0018208946983, allows for unique identification within distribution systems.

Image Quality

Equipped with a 20.8 MP CMOS sensor, the Nikon D5 guarantees images of exceptional quality, capturing every detail with remarkable precision. Its maximum resolution of 5568 x 3712 pixels ensures superior clarity and definition. The supported image format is RAW, allowing for maximum flexibility during post-processing. The sensor size, measuring 35.6 x 23.9 mm, also contributes to excellent light and detail management.

Lens System

The Nikon D5 is designed to enable precise shooting, although the exact specifications regarding optical and digital zoom are not provided. The focal length and aperture are also unspecified, but they are essential for determining the field of view and image quality in various lighting situations.

Focusing

For precise focusing, the Nikon D5 offers several autofocus modes, including Multi Point Auto Focus, Single Auto Focus, and Tracking Auto Focus. Additionally, it provides a manual focus option, allowing users to customize their photographic experience according to their needs.

Light Exposure

The camera's ISO sensitivity is variable, offering flexibility in various lighting conditions. Exposure compensation is adjustable to ±5EV, allowing for precise management of image brightness. The light measurement is center-weighted and spot, ensuring optimal results by focusing on specific areas of the scene.

Shutter

The Nikon D5 uses a mechanical shutter, ensuring fast and precise image capture, even in fast-moving situations. The maximum and minimum shutter speeds are not specified, but they are crucial for photography in varied conditions, especially in low light.

Flash

The flash modes include Auto, Fill-in, red-eye reduction, and slow sync, allowing for adaptable lighting as needed. The sync speed is 1/250 s, and the flash range is optimized for shooting at various distances.

Video

The Nikon D5 allows video recording with a maximum resolution of 3840 x 2160 pixels, thus providing immersive image quality in 4K Ultra HD. The various video resolutions, ranging from 1280 x 720 to 3840 x 2160, ensure great flexibility for users.

Audio

Equipped with a built-in microphone, the Nikon D5 allows for clear and precise audio capture. Its stereo audio system offers quality sound experience, and it is capable of recording voices and sounds with excellent fidelity.

Memory

The Nikon D5 supports CF and XQD memory cards, providing efficient storage for large volumes of data. The number of memory slots is two, allowing for optimized management of photographic files.

Screen

Its 3.2-inch AMOLED screen ensures superior image quality. The screen is touch-sensitive and tiltable, providing intuitive navigation and optimal visual comfort.

Viewfinder

The optical viewfinder of the Nikon D5 allows for precise composition and optimal framing, essential for professional photographers.

Connectivity

The Nikon D5 is equipped with features such as PictBridge for direct printing, USB 3.2 Gen 1 connectivity for fast data transfer, and an HDMI output for transmitting high-quality videos and audio.

Camera

The white balance is adjustable with several options, allowing for color optimization based on lighting conditions. The various scene modes, such as Night Portrait and Sports, help maximize image quality according to the context. The self-timer offers options from 2 to 20 seconds, facilitating the capture of images from a distance.

Other Features

The Nikon D5 operates with a battery ensuring optimal performance, and it is designed to withstand various environmental conditions, with an operating temperature ranging from 0 to 40 °C.

Weight and Dimensions

With a width of 160 mm, a height of 158.5 mm, and a depth of 92 mm, the Nikon D5 is designed for easy handling. Its weight of 1415 g (including battery) makes it robust while remaining portable.

Packaging Contents

The product comes with a quick start guide, facilitating its use from the first handling.
